Description:
Explore the fundamentals of carbon capture and storage in this 33-minute lecture from Stanford University's Understand Energy course. Delve into the reasons behind carbon capture implementation, the mechanics of how it works, potential risks associated with the technology, and global developments in CCS projects. Presented by Lynn Orr, Keleen and Carlton Beal Professor in Petroleum Engineering at Stanford's Doerr School of Sustainability, this comprehensive overview covers key topics including the necessity of carbon capture, its operational processes, risk assessment, and the current state of CCS initiatives worldwide. Gain valuable insights into this crucial technology for addressing climate change and enhancing energy sustainability as part of Stanford's mission to improve global energy literacy.
